Technical Field
The utility model relates to the technical field of stoves, in particular to a portable safe fuel chafing dish stove.
Background
At present, fire boilers which are used in restaurants and used for eating and eating carbon as combustion materials do not have a fire isolating device, and if people need to isolate fire or reduce the temperature of the furnace to boil food, people often need to water and extinguish some burnt carbon, which is not safe, generates a large amount of dense smoke and affects the appetite and mood of eaters, so the fire boilers which supply energy through small gas pipes are popularized.
However, the pot supporting frame of the existing fuel chafing dish stove cannot be adjusted.
However, different pots have different specifications and cannot be adjusted, the practicability of the chafing dish stove is reduced, a plurality of pots with different sizes cannot be placed, certain difficulty is caused to use, the baffle of the existing chafing dish stove is in the shape of a scissor edge, the adjusting effect and the fire extinguishing effect are not ideal, and the existing chafing dish stove can only be ignited by adopting an ignition gun or a lighter independently when being ignited, so that the chafing dish stove is troublesome to operate and has lower safety.

Portable safety fuel chafing dish stove, including furnace body (1), its characterized in that, the top of furnace body (1) is provided with supporting part (2), one side of furnace body (1) is provided with portion of opening and shutting (3) and ignition portion (4), supporting part (2) include can dismantle the top cap of being connected and four symmetries with furnace body (1) top set up support piece (205) of four corners at top cap top, the top center department of top cap sets up through-hole (5) that run through the top cap, the sliding tray has all been seted up to four corners at the top of top cap and the bottom position that is located support piece (205), the bottom of support piece (205) can be dismantled and be connected with connecting seat (204) with the inside sliding connection of sliding tray, curb plate (203) of connecting the connection can be dismantled to one side fixedly connected with top cap of connecting seat (204).
2. The portable safe fuel chafing dish according to claim 1, wherein the inside of the sliding groove is horizontally provided with a guide rod (201) whose two ends are respectively fixedly connected with the two inner walls of the sliding groove, and the bottom of the connecting base (204) is fixedly connected with a sliding piece (202) matched with the guide rod (201) through a bolt.
3. Portable safety fuel chafing dish according to claim 2, wherein the bottom of the support member (205) is bolted fixedly with the top of the connecting seat (204).
4. A portable safety fuel chafing dish according to claim 3, wherein the top of said side plate (203) is provided with positioning holes, and the top of the top cover is provided with a plurality of positioning holes along the horizontal direction of the sliding groove and located at one side of each sliding groove.
5. The portable safe fuel chafing dish stove according to claim 1, characterized in that, the portion of opening and shutting (3) include two symmetries set up baffle (301) in the top cap bottom and with the driving gear dish (305) of being connected is rotated to the inside one side of furnace body (1), two the bottom of baffle (301) and the equal fixedly connected with pinion rack (302) of one side that is close to driving gear dish (305), one side of driving gear dish (305) is connected with driven gear dish (303) through vice driven gear dish (304) meshing, and the other side meshing is connected with driven gear dish two (306), driven gear dish one (303) and driven gear dish two (306) are connected with adjacent pinion rack (302) meshing through the latch respectively.
6. The portable safe fuel chafing dish furnace according to claim 1, wherein the ignition part (4) comprises an ignition rod (401) horizontally arranged at the bottom of one side of the furnace body (1) and a push rod (402) rotatably connected to one side of the furnace body (1), one side of the bottom of the push rod (402) is in contact with one end of the ignition rod (401), one side of the push rod (402) is provided with a limit spring (403), one end of the limit spring (403) is elastically connected with one side of the furnace body (1), and the other end of the limit spring is elastically connected with one side of the push rod (402).
